Familial chylomicronemia syndrome: what the trials found

Plozasiran demonstrated significant reductions in fasting serum triglycerides (TG) at month 10 (-85.7%, -89.5%, and 38.8%; p=0.0022) and when averaged over months 10 and 12 (-82.1%, -86.6%, and 49.5%; p=0.0055). Additionally, it significantly reduced fasting serum Apolipoprotein C3 (APOC3) at month 10 (-92.55%, -91.83%, and 19.91%; p=0.0008).

Volanesorsen showed significant reductions in fasting triglycerides by month 3, with a mean percent change of -76.5% and -49.2% across different reported cohorts [2, 4]. In one trial, Volanesorsen achieved an absolute reduction in fasting TG of -1712 mg/dL (p<0.0001) and a treatment response rate where participants reached <750 mg/dL at month 3 (p=0.0001) 2.

Olezarsen significantly reduced fasting triglycerides at both month 6 (-10.85% and -31.99%; p=0.0009) and month 12 (-22.92% and -38.50%; p=0.0044). It also demonstrated significant reductions in Apolipoprotein C-III (apoC-III) at both time points 3.

For the clinician treating this condition

  • Plozasiran provides significant reductions in both fasting triglycerides and APOC3 levels 1.
  • Volanesorsen is associated with substantial decreases in fasting triglyceride levels and high rates of achieving target TG thresholds [2, 4].
  • Olezarsen effectively reduces fasting triglycerides and apoC-III levels over a 12-month period 3.
